The third call for the Government’s Nico-Broadband Program will allow an improvement of services to almost 9,500 families and companies in Galicia

The Government delegate in Galicia, Pedro Blanco, has announced the investment of €19.7 million in the third call for the Single-Broadband Program, managed by the Ministry of Economic Affairs and Digital Transformation through the Secretary of State for Telecommunications and Digital Infrastructure, for the fiber extension to rural areas of the community.

This phase of the project will allow the advent of ultra-fast digital connectivity, bringing Internet connection via fiber optics to 9,249 families and businesses in rural areasof the community. This call was opened last Monday and will remain open until next September 15. Until that date, telecommunications companies may submit their proposals.

The greater investment will be carried out in the province of Pontevedra, with 7.7 million euros to benefit 3,621 users; followed by A Corua, with 4.6 for 2,206 households and companies; in Lugo another 4.6 will be invested for 2,319 users; and in Ourense 2.8 million for 1,283 homes and businesses

The central government subsidizes 80% of the cost of the projects, and the companies contribute the remainder up to the entire cost of these actions. The projects must be completed before December 31, 2025.

In totalhe Nico-Broadband Program represents an investment of €90.9 million to improve network connection services in 236,154 Galician households and companies.
